
Apple App Store Sales Jump In May, Boosting Outlook For Services Growth

I'm PortAI, I can summarize articles.
JP Morgan analyst Samik Chatterjee maintains an Overweight rating on Apple Inc, noting a 4.9% month-over-month increase in App Store revenue for May, supporting a 13.0% year-over-year growth. Despite no official guidance for Services revenue, trends suggest low-double-digit growth. App Store downloads rose 2.0% month-over-month. However, concerns arise from reduced growth expectations for iPhone shipments due to tariff uncertainties. Apple stock closed down 0.22% at $202.82.
